What sets Rishikesh apart as a yoga destination?

Rishikesh is a small town located in the foothills of the Himalayas, on the banks of the holy river Ganges. It is considered to be one of India's most spiritual destinations and has gained global recognition as the "Yoga Capital of the World". This serene town offers a unique blend of spirituality, nature, and culture that sets it apart from other yoga destinations.

 

One of the main factors that makes Rishikesh stand out as a yoga destination is its rich history and heritage. The ancient practice of yoga originated in India thousands of years ago, and Rishikesh has been an important hub for yogis since then. It is said that Lord Shiva himself practiced yoga in this sacred land. Many renowned yogis have come here to meditate and attain enlightenment over the centuries, making Rishikesh a significant place for spiritual seekers.

Curriculum and daily schedule of a typical training program

The curriculum and daily schedule of a typical training program in Rishikesh for yoga teacher training is carefully design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of the ancient practice. Located in the birthplace of yoga, Rishikesh offers an immersive and authentic experience for those looking to deepen their knowledge and skills in teaching yoga.

The curriculum typically covers various aspects of yoga such as philosophy, anatomy, asanas (postures), pranayama (breathing techniques), meditation, and teaching methodology. Students will also have the opportunity to delve into the history and origins of yoga, gaining a deeper appreciation for its spiritual roots.

In addition to theoretical studies, students will engage in practical sessions where they will learn how to sequence classes, adjust poses according to different body types and abilities, use props effectively, and incorporate modifications for injuries or limitations. This hands-on approach gives students valuable experience that prepares them for real-life teaching scenarios.
